People First Federal Credit Union Golf Classic raises $15,000 for area non-profits

People First Federal Credit Union held its annual Golf Classic on September 26, 2022 at Northampton Country Club to raise money for three local non-profits.  This is the 12th year that the Credit Union has held the fundraiser.  Led by the People First Board of Directors, the fundraiser has benefitted multiple charities in the region over the years including most recently, The Children's Home of Easton, Tails of Valor, Haven House and LifePath.

This year, People First raised a record amount with all proceeds going to Habitat for Humanity of the Lehigh Valley, The Literacy Center, and Battle Borne.  The Board of Directors votes on the charities that align with the Credit Union’s four key pillars for community engagement: Human Services, Youth Development and Education, Health including Mental Health, and Diversity, Equity, Inclusion and Accessibility.

“We’re always looking to build, strengthen and lift the communities we serve. We do that in many ways, including our annual charity golf classic,” said Howard Meller, President/CEO of People First. “It’s all part of our mission to do everything we can for our community and be outstanding corporate citizens.”

The Golf Classic was attended by 97 golfers.  Co-Title sponsors were Allied Solutions, Gallagher, Interface and Strategic Resource Management. Prizes were awarded to the top three teams, as well as for the longest and straightest drives, the “Pot of Gold” closest shot to the pin, and the annual Hole-in-One contest.
